The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 1987 Catalina sailboat offers a blend of classic design and reliable performance, making it a popular choice among sailing enthusiasts. Here are some pros and cons to consider:
Pros
Spacious Interior: The 1987 Catalina is known for its roomy cabin, providing comfortable accommodations for extended cruising.
Solid Construction: Built with quality materials, this model offers durability and a sturdy feel on the water.
Easy Handling: With a well-balanced sail plan and manageable size, it is suitable for both novice and experienced sailors.
Good Performance: It delivers respectable sailing performance, especially in moderate wind conditions.
Community Support: Being a well-known model, parts and aftermarket support are generally accessible.
Cons
Older Design Elements: As a boat from 1987, some design features and onboard systems may feel dated compared to modern sailboats.
Maintenance Needs: Older boats often require more upkeep, including potential updates to rigging, electronics, and plumbing.
Weight: The Catalina tends to be heavier, which can affect speed and maneuverability in light winds.
Limited Headroom: While spacious, some areas may have limited standing headroom, which could impact comfort for taller individuals.
